High-frequency oscillatory ventilation with or without volume guarantee during neonatal transport

摘要

Objectives

To analyse deviation of ventilator parameters from their set targets during high-frequency oscillatory ventilation (HFOV) with or without volume guarantee (VG) and compare the two modes during emergency neonatal transport.

Study design

Retrospective observational study using the fabian™ HFOi ventilator.

Results

Median deviation of mean airway pressure from the set value was <1 cmH2O. During HFOV the pressure amplitude differed from the set value by <1 cmH2O. During HFOV-VG median deviation of the oscillation volume (VThf) from the targeted value was −0.07 mL/kg, but in some cases VThf was by >0.38 mL/kg below target. Setting maximum allowed amplitude 10 cmH2O above the usually required amplitude improved maintenance of VThf. HFOV and HFOV-VG parameters were similar, except the lower amplitude during HFOV without VG. VThf <2.5 mL/kg avoided hypercapnia in most cases.

Conclusions

HFOV and HFOV-VG maintain ventilator parameters close to their targets and are promising modalities during neonatal transport.
